I am writing this letter in response to Mr. Ted Howze’s letter to the editor, published in the March 24 issue of the Turlock Journal.
I am saddened that you have to resort to character assassination of our wonderful mayor, John Lazar.
From the jest of your letter, it appears that you may be running in the next mayoral election, and, therefore, I conclude that your accusations are driven by your private interest in the matter and are, therefore, completely unfounded and self-serving.
If you decide to run, be assured that I, for one, will campaign vigorously against you.
— Jean Helbig
LAFCO needs a true public member
letters
What is LAFCO? It’s a commission with the unusual name, Local Agency Formation Commission – LAFCO. It was authorized by the California State Legislature in 1963. All 58 counties in California have a LAFCO.
